With out going back though the files, what are your feelings on riding with weather checked tires? Both my CH150's have some checking in each tire. We are...
As long as the checking is mild/light and not exposing the chord you are OK. Once the cord is exposed, water damages it making it weak and more prone to...
Tires are stamped with a week and year stamp. If they are over 10 years old I would not trust my life or even my vacation on them. Ride safe Mark Peder in...
